Willis Alan Ramsey recorded one classic album on Leon's Shelter
 records back in 73 or 74.  The album has been reissued on CD.

The notation is as follows:  the numbers correspond to the key
 scale notes.  In the key of A, 1 = A; 2 = B; b3 = C where
 3 = C#, etc.  The extensions are 1dom7 = A7; 1j7 = Amaj7;
 1- or 1-7 = Am or Am7.  No extension makes the chord simply
 a major triad.  The | is a bar line and / is a beat within a
 measure that designates playing the same as previous chord.
  No bar lines means the chord will get an entire measure's
 time.  Two chords per measure split the measure exactly in
 half.  W.A. actually plays in different tunings, these
 changes are really implied voicings.
